骆建华 %A 姚敏 %J 软件学报 %D 1999 %I %X In this paper, the authors propose a fast B wavelet transform method in spectrum domain and step spectrum analysis theory for extracting completed magnetic resonance(MR) spectrum data from the MR truncated data, and the reconstruction image. In this method, the feature information is abstracted from the available low-frequency MR data using B wavelet method, and then high-frequency components are exerted from the feature information and whole spectrum data is recovered by using step spectrum analysis theory(SSAT), at last MR image is reconstructed from the recovered completed spectrum data by FFT(fast Fourier transform). Experiment and simulation results show that this method gives much better reconstructed image than the available method. %K Step spectrum analysis %K signal fantastic points %K signal fantastic degree
